Investment thesis

Great Wave Ventures is an early-stage VC firm focused on technology in the built world, particularly real estate and construction (proptech), while reserving some capital for compelling companies beyond that core focus. Founded in 2021, the firm has invested in around 70 startups, including 25 Y Combinator graduates. It positions itself as a partner that supports founders at the right inflection points in their businesses.

Climate Capital

Climate Capital runs a "Network Fund" as an AngelList rolling micro-fund that writes many small checks ($10k–$25k) into the top 10–20 climate startups per quarter, giving individual LPs "large fund" diversification with low minimums through a structure much closer to an angel-syndicate model than a traditional closed-end VC fund. The firm has deliberately built a very large, democratized LP base of 2,000+ individual LPs via its rolling Network Fund and syndicate, turning climate-interested operators and angels into co-investors and creating a distribution/mentorship network for founders that is structurally different from the small institutional LP bases of most VC funds.
